Modern trumpets have 3 (or, infrequently, four) piston shutoffs, each of which increases the length of tubes when engaged, consequently decreasing the pitch. The very first shutoff lowers the instrument's pitch by an entire action (two semitones), the 2nd shutoff by a half step (one semitone), and the third shutoff by one and a half steps (3 semitones). Made use of singly and in mix these shutoffs make the instrument completely colorful, i.e., able to play all twelve pitches of symphonic music. The metal trumpet dates from the second millennium bce in Egypt, when it was a tiny routine or armed forces tool sounding only one or more notes. Later on kinds included the natural trumpet of the 16th-- 18th centuries and, complying with the creation of shutoffs concerning 1815, the modern valve trumpet.

Leadpipe humming is made use of for the term when we take out the adjusting slide from the trumpet, yet insert the mouthpiece into the leadpipe and play on the mouthpiece inserted into the leadpipe. The leadpipe buzzing tries to prevent the cons of the mouthpiece or complimentary humming because the longer tube enables a nicer noise, much more near to the trumpet. The origins of the trumpet can be mapped back to ancient people, where primitive kinds of the instrument were utilized for numerous ritualistic and military functions. In Egypt, as early as 1500 BCE, representations of trumpet-like instruments adorned the wall surfaces of burial places, showcasing their duty in spiritual rituals and processions. Likewise, old Greeks and Romans made use of trumpet-like instruments during armed forces projects and public occasions.
